Bernie Taupin - A Biographical Look at His Start

Bernie Taupin, born in Lincolnshire, England, began his story in a quiet, somewhat country setting. His early days were, you know, a bit different from what you might picture for someone who would go on to write some of the biggest songs in history. He grew up on a farm, surrounded by the natural world, which some people say helped him develop a rich imagination and a way with words. He wasn't really a fan of formal schooling, finding more comfort in books and poetry than in classrooms.

His interest in words and writing really started to show itself when he was quite young. He would, in fact, spend a lot of time reading, taking in stories and different kinds of writing, which helped him build a big vocabulary and a strong sense of how words fit together. This early passion for literature was, arguably, a clear sign of what was to come. He was, as a matter of fact, always writing, putting down thoughts and feelings, even before he knew what they might become.

The pivotal moment in his life, the one that really set him on his path, happened in 1967. He answered an advertisement in a music paper, a notice from Liberty Records looking for new songwriters. This simple act of replying to a newspaper ad led him to meet a young piano player named Reg Dwight, who would later become known to the world as Elton John. This meeting, you know, was a turning point for both of them, sparking one of the most successful and enduring songwriting partnerships in the history of popular music. It was, basically, a chance encounter that changed everything for both artists, shaping their futures in ways they could not have imagined.

How Did Bernie Taupin's Creative Process Shape His Words?

People often wonder how a writer like Bernie Taupin comes up with so many memorable lines. His way of working is, actually, quite interesting and a bit unusual compared to many songwriters. He typically writes the words first, without any music in mind. He just puts down his thoughts, his stories, his feelings, letting the language flow freely onto the page. This approach means the words stand on their own, holding their own weight and meaning before any melody is even considered.

This method, where the lyrics are created independently, allows for a real purity in the storytelling. He isn't trying to fit words into a pre-existing tune; instead, the words themselves guide the feeling and rhythm that the music will eventually take on. It's almost like, you know, painting a picture with words, and then someone else comes along and adds the perfect colors and sounds to it. This kind of separation between lyric and melody is what makes their partnership so unique.

Once the lyrics are ready, he passes them along to Elton John. Elton then takes these written pieces and crafts the music around them, finding the right chords and rhythms to bring the words to life in a song. This collaborative method has worked for decades, showing just how well they understand each other's artistic contributions. It's a testament to their deep connection, really, that they can work in such a distinct way and produce such wonderful results, time and time again. Beyond the Lyrics - Exploring the Life and Legacy of Bernie Taupin in Other Ventures

While Bernie Taupin is most widely known for his songwriting, his creative spirit isn't limited to just putting words to music. He has, in fact, ventured into several other artistic areas, showing that his talent extends beyond the written word. This broader scope of work helps us get a fuller picture of his overall artistic contributions and how he expresses himself in different ways. It's, you know, quite interesting to see how he applies his creative mind to various forms.

One of his other significant pursuits is visual art. He is an accomplished painter and sculptor, creating pieces that often reflect the same kind of storytelling and emotional depth found in his lyrics. His artwork has been shown in galleries, and it often features bold colors and expressive forms, sometimes with a raw, almost primitive feel. This artistic expression allows him to explore themes and feelings in a different medium, giving him another outlet for his ideas. It's, basically, another way for him to communicate.

He has also written books, including a memoir and a collection of poetry. These written works, separate from his song lyrics, offer deeper insights into his thoughts and experiences, providing a more direct look at his mind. These projects allow him to share his personal stories and observations without the constraints of a musical structure, giving readers a chance to connect with his voice in a new way. He has, you know, always been a writer, in many forms.

Furthermore, Taupin has been involved in film and television projects, sometimes contributing to screenplays or working on other creative aspects behind the scenes. These diverse activities show his ongoing desire to create and his willingness to explore different artistic avenues. His work in these various fields demonstrates that his creative energy is, pretty much, boundless, and that he is always looking for new ways to express himself and share his perspective with the world.
